Requirements

  • We do not expect applicants to have studied actuarial science, but they should be curious to learn about insurance. Alongside this, we look for the following attributes in our interns:
  • Studying towards a relevant numerical degree with statistical content (e.g., Actuarial Science, Mathematics, Economics, Physics).
  • Analytical – Our roles require a great deal of problem-solving and so we need to be able to think of solutions given the resources and data that we have.
  • Decisive – A consultant gives expert advice within a technical or professional field and so we must be able to make clear and informed choices.
  • Supportive – We expect 4mosters to be inclusive, compassionate and helpful.
  • Honest – We do not always know the answer, but we will find it! We expect you to be transparent in your approach and demonstrate integrity.
  • Self-motivated – We are always striving to improve and so it is important that you are keen to develop both yourself and 4most alike.

Responsibilities

  • The 10-week internship programme will be split into 2 parts:
  • Part 1 - will cover sector background information, regulations, interactive coding workshops and independent practice assignments.
  • Part 2 - will be a practical project either working individually or as part of a team where you will have the opportunity to apply your technical and soft skills. You will also showcase your consulting abilities by presenting your results to senior 4mosters at the end of the project.
  • All interns are assigned a ‘buddy’ (usually a recent graduate) for the full duration of the internship programme who will be able to support them and answer questions about the tasks/assignments and working at 4most in general.
  • Informative sessions:
  • Includes high-level introductions to insurance and insurance products, Solvency II, IFRS 17, introduction to modelling languages for insurance, modelling in Excel, economics overview, model validation and an introduction to credit risk.
  • Technical workshops:
  • Interactive workshops covering Excel and R.
  • Learning basic data steps/manipulation, data investigation and analysis, understanding and writing macros and basic model creation.
  • Assignments:
  • Interns will be given short assignments to complete which relate to the theory and technical workshops covered.
  • Project:
  • The final segment of the internship allows the interns to put all skills and knowledge learnt towards a project which involves research, analysis, creative problem solving and presenting a solution with supported rationale.
  • Graduate progression:
  • Successfully showcasing your skills through the 10-week internship could land you a place on our Insurance Graduate programme at 4most. This is where you will translate the technical and soft skills you have learned through the internship to the next stage of your career

Application Process

  • CV review and application form
  • We will assess your CV and the answers you provided to our application questions.
  • Online assessments
  • These will allow you to demonstrate your Excel, critical thinking and numerical skills through three short tasks.
  • Telephone interview
  • This stage allows us to get to know you through a 30-minute session with a 4moster. This also gives you an opportunity to get to know us.
  • Face-to-face interview
  • The final stage is a face-to-face interview at our London office with two 4mosters. This is also a chance for you to see who we are as a company and to ask any questions you might have!

Mission & Purpose

4most is a global specialist risk analytics consultancy. We work with clients ranging from challenger banks to world-leading international financial institutions to design, build and implement regulatory, non-regulatory, and pricing solutions in the credit and actuarial risk market.
